Instructions
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Line a large baking sheet or pizza pan with parchment paper.
In a large mixing bowl, combine the ground Italian sausage, beaten egg, 1/2 cup of mozzarella, grated Parmesan cheese, and Italian seasoning. Use your hands to mix thoroughly until all ingredients are well incorporated.
Transfer the sausage mixture to the center of the prepared baking sheet. Press it out evenly into a 10-12 inch circle, about 1/4 inch thick, to form the pizza crust. Build up a slightly thicker edge to act as a crust rim.
Bake the sausage crust for 10-12 minutes, or until it is cooked through and lightly browned. Remove from the oven and carefully drain off any excess grease from the pan.
Spread the low-carb marinara sauce evenly over the pre-baked sausage crust, leaving a small border around the edge. Sprinkle the remaining 1 cup of mozzarella cheese over the sauce. Arrange the sliced green and red bell peppers on top.
Return the pizza to the oven and bake for another 8-10 minutes, or until the cheese is melted, bubbly, and slightly golden. You can switch to the broiler for the last 1-2 minutes for extra browning, but watch it carefully.
Let the pizza cool on the pan for 5 minutes before slicing with a pizza cutter. This helps it set and makes for cleaner slices. Serve immediately.
Notes
Chef's Tip: For a crispier crust, after draining the grease, pat the surface of the sausage crust gently with a paper towel before adding toppings.Variations: Feel free to add other low-carb toppings like mushrooms, onions, black olives, or pepperoni.Storage: Store leftover pizza in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at in the oven or an air fryer for best results.
